林克(linq)和sql语句(sql)的区别

LINQ和SQL的主要区别在于,LINQ是Microsoft.NET framework组件,它为.NET语言添加了本机数据查询功能,而SQL是在RDBMS中存储和管理数据的标准语言。...

LINQ和SQL的主要区别在于,LINQ是Microsoft.NET framework组件,它为.NET语言添加了本机数据查询功能,而SQL是在RDBMS中存储和管理数据的标准语言。

通常,LINQ提供C#或VB.NET等语言的语法,以对各种数据源和格式的可用数据执行操作。它还减少了常用编程语言和数据库之间的不匹配和复杂性。简而言之,LINQ是一种内置于.NET语言中的结构化查询语法。另一方面,DBMS是一种使数据管理更容易的软件。另外,RDBMS是按照关系模型设计的数据库管理系统,SQL是在RDBMS中进行insert、update、delete、select等操作的语言。

覆盖的关键领域

1.什么是LINQ定义,功能2.什么是SQL定义,功能3。LINQ和SQL之间的关系-概述关联4.LINQ和SQL之间的差异-关键差异的比较

关键术语

LINQ、.NET框架、RDBMS、SQL

林克(linq)和sql语句(sql)的区别

什么是林克(linq)?

通常需要将应用程序与数据库(如MySQL和MSSQL)连接起来。但是,程序员可能会发现将应用程序与数据库或web服务连接起来是一个困难的过程。因此,LINQ为这个问题提供了一个解决方案。它允许连接具有不同数据源的应用程序,如集合、ADO.NET数据集、XML文档、web服务以及MySQL和MSSQL等数据库。

通常,LINQ查询类似于SQL,带有select、orderby和where等操作符。查询表达式以关键字“from”开头。程序员必须导入名称空间System.Query以访问程序中的标准LINQ查询运算符。此外,如果程序员对基于.NET的语言、SQL和其他相关API有一定的了解,他就可以编写有效的LINQ查询。

什么是sql语句(sql)?

SQL是一种ANSI/ISO标准数据库语言,有助于在RDBMS中存储和管理数据。此外,程序员还可以编写SQL查询来创建数据库和表,**、更新和删除表中的数据,创建索引和许多其他任务。

林克(linq)和sql语句(sql)的区别

SQL语言主要分为三大类;DDL、DML、DCL。数据定义语言(DDL)命令有助于更改数据库和相关对象的结构。CREATE、ALTER和DROP是一些DDL命令。此外,数据操作语言(DML)命令允许操作表中的数据。INSERT、UPDATE、DELETE和SELECT是一些常见的DML命令。最后,数据控制语言(DCL)命令定义了可以访问数据库中数据的用户的访问级别。GRANT和REVOKE是DCL命令的两个示例。

linq与sql的关系

  • LINQ是基于SQL的。

林克(linq)和sql语句(sql)的区别

定义

LINQ是一个Microsoft.NET framework组件,它将本机数据查询功能添加到.NET语言中。它最初是在2007年作为.net framework 3.5的主要部分发布的,而SQL是一种用于编程的领域特定语言,用于管理关系数据库管理系统中的数据。因此,这就解释了LINQ和SQL之间的根本区别。

代表

此外,LINQ代表语言集成查询,SQL代表结构化查询语言。

重要性

在功能上,LINQ是.NET framework的一个组件,用于执行本机数据查询,而SQL是一种结构化查询语言,用于保存和检索数据库中的数据。因此,这是LINQ和SQL之间的主要区别。

结论

LINQ和SQL的主要区别在于,LINQ是一个Microsoft.NET framework组件,它为.NET语言添加了本机数据查询功能,而SQL是在RDBMS中存储和管理数据的标准语言。简而言之,如果程序员正在编写一个C应用程序,那么他可以通过编写LINQ查询将该应用程序连接到数据库(如MSSQL)。

引用

1,“语言集成查询”,维基百科,维基媒体基金会,2019年6月3日,可在这里。2.“什么是LINQ”什么是LINQ,这里有。3,“SQL”维基百科,维基媒体基金会,2019年5月21日,可在这里。 2.“什么是林克。”林克是什么, 3,“SQL”维基百科,维基媒体基金会,2019年5月21日,

  • 发表于 2021-07-01 22:56
  • 阅读 ( 455 )
  • 分类:IT

你可能感兴趣的文章

联盟(union)和sqlserver中的union all(union all in sql server)的区别

...set操作。工会就是其中之一。 Union组合两个或多个select语句的结果。此后,它将返回结果而不返回任何重复行。要执行此操作,表应该具有相同的列数和相同的数据类型。参考以下两个表格。 第一个表是s1,第二个表是s2。执...

  • 发布于 2020-10-18 10:13
  • 阅读 ( 232 )

sql语句(sql)和hql公司(hql)的区别

SQL与HQL 结构化查询语言(structuredquerylanguage,也称SQL)是一种数据库语言,它使用关系数据库管理的概念来管理数据。数据的管理包括select(从单个或多个表中检索数据)、insert(在表中添加一行或多行)、update(负责更改表...

  • 发布于 2021-06-23 19:43
  • 阅读 ( 302 )

odbc数据库(odbc)和sql语句(sql)的区别

ODBC与SQL ODBC或Open Database Connectivity是一个网关,它为VB、Excel、access等应用程序提供对不同数据源或数据库的访问。它的特点是一组错误代码、数据类型和有助于开发应用程序的函数。当应用程序需要同时访问多个数据源时,ODBC...

  • 发布于 2021-06-23 20:06
  • 阅读 ( 294 )

jdbc语句(jdbc statement)和编制报表(preparedstatement)的区别

...。 Statement和PreparedStatement是表示与数据库服务器交互的SQL语句的类。让我们详细讨论一下,解释一下两者的区别。 什么是陈述(statement)? 语句是一个JDBC接口,用于对SQL数据库的通用访问,特别是在运行时使用静态SQL语句时。 ...

  • 发布于 2021-06-25 10:39
  • 阅读 ( 261 )

python(python)和sql语句(sql)的区别

...常与面向对象编程(OOP)相关的所有概念。   什么是sql语句(sql)? 1970年,E。F。IBM研究实验室的Codd发表了一篇题为“大型共享数据库的数据关系模型”的论文,该论文建议将数据表示为一组表。论文发表后不久,IBM成立了一...

  • 发布于 2021-06-26 03:38
  • 阅读 ( 1090 )

hadoop软件(hadoop)和sql语句(sql)的区别

...架,以便提供方便的访问和动态加载数据。   什么是sql语句(sql)? SQL是访问和操作数据库中数据的普遍工具。SQ服务器不再是开发人员、数据库管理员和分析人员使用的常规数据库管理系统。它是一个巨大的生态系统,它包含...

  • 发布于 2021-06-26 11:15
  • 阅读 ( 596 )

sql语句(sql)和mysql数据库(mysql)的区别

...比较 关键术语 SQL、MySQL、数据库、关系数据库 什么是sql语句(sql)? 组织使用数据库存储数据。关系数据库将数据存储在表中,这些表相互关联。这些数据库称为关系数据库。结构化查询语言(SQL)是帮助在关系数据库中存储、...

  • 发布于 2021-06-30 18:44
  • 阅读 ( 412 )

存储过程(stored procedure)和功能(function)的区别

...在于,存储过程是一组可以在关系数据库上反复执行的SQL语句,而函数是一组使用编程语言编写的可以反复执行的指令。 关系数据库管理系统(RDBMS)是基于关系模型的数据库管理系统。它将数据存储在数据库中。每个数据库由...

  • 发布于 2021-06-30 23:16
  • 阅读 ( 1061 )

sql语句(sql)和plsql语言(plsql)的区别

...体用途是管理Oracle关系数据库中的数据。SQL一次执行一条语句,而PLSQL一次执行一个语句块。总之,SQL是通用的查询语言,PLSQL是专门用于Oracle数据库的查询语言。 覆盖的关键领域 1.什么是SQL–定义,特性2.什么是PLSQL–定义,特...

  • 发布于 2021-06-30 23:38
  • 阅读 ( 250 )

变量(variable)和sql中的参数(parameter in sql)的区别

...诸如MSSQL之类的RDBMS使用变量和参数,我们可以在SQL过程语句中的任何地方引用这些变量和参数。 覆盖的关键领域 1.什么是SQL中的变量–定义,功能2.什么是SQL中的参数–定义,功能3.SQL中的变量和参数之间的区别是什么–关键区...

  • 发布于 2021-07-01 06:02
  • 阅读 ( 613 )
zufj0091
zufj0091

0 篇文章

相关推荐